Team treatment
Group treatment is a kind of psychotherapy that includes a team of people with the exact same psychological health problem. It can aid beginners get self-confidence in communicating with other individuals and find out new methods for managing their issues. It likewise helps them understand that they are not alone, which can be a relief for lots of people.

Unlike casual support groups, team treatment sessions are led by a qualified therapist. She or he might suggest a topic for discussion or permit team members to choose the style. This framework permits participants to discuss their issues in an encouraging setting and urges positive habits adjustments.

In addition, the variety of point of views shared by team participants can be helpful. They may provide different techniques to managing comparable problems, such as addictions or stress and anxiety conditions. This direct exposure can broaden an individual's sight of the globe and raise their compassion. However, this benefit only works if the group operates on principles of respect and empathy.

Intensive outpatient treatment (IOP).
Intensive outpatient therapy (IOP) is a step down from inpatient therapy and enables individuals to keep day-to-day duties while participating in treatment sessions. It typically involves several hours of group or individual therapy sessions each day for a few weeks, and participants are encouraged to take part in family and support groups as well. IOP programs are generally covered by health insurance, and many companies have sliding-scale charges or payment plans.

IOP programs likewise provide the chance to apply the new abilities found out in holistic mental health treatment to day-to-day life, which aids individuals construct self-confidence and self-direction. Furthermore, they commonly consist of academic seminars on managing stress and coping strategies.

IOP programs make use of cognitive behavior modification (CBT) strategies, which show people how to recognize and reframe their thoughts and feelings. These methods can assist avoid relapse. Many people locate it much easier to discover these skills in an intensive outpatient program, where they can exercise them while living in the house.

Cognitive behavior modification (CBT).
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) is a type of talk treatment that assists you discover healthier means to handle your thoughts, emotions, and habits. This sort of therapy is often made use of to treat mental wellness conditions, however it can also be handy for individuals who are fighting with everyday concerns such as anxiety, relationship problems, and occupational stress and anxiety.

CBT focuses on mentor you how to test unfavorable thoughts and change them with even more rational ones. It is an ambitious, time-limited treatment that may be incorporated with medication for extra efficient results. It is necessary to discover a therapist that specializes in your details condition and understands your requirements. It is also an excellent idea to examine your health insurance protection and see the number of sessions are covered each year.

The initial session of CBT typically contains an evaluation and conversation of your goals. Your specialist will certainly ask questions regarding your present situation and will certainly work with you to create a plan that will certainly help you conquer your difficulties.
